Days later and I STILL can't stop thinking about my Bran Bran, Saint and THAT ENDING!Sancte Diaboli is Part One of Brantley and Saint's duet and book 6 in The Elite Kings Club series by Amo Jones. Sancte Diaboli is is a full-length Dark Romance written in Dual POV, through our main characters, Brantley Vitiosis and Saint Dea Vitiosis.Sancte Diaboli picks up not far after Malum Part II ended, Bishop is wallowing in self-pity, Tillie misses her best friend and Madison is still hiding over the other side of the world. And Brantley is biding his time...Of the 6 books so far in The Elite Kings Series, Sancte Diaboli is my favourite of the series. I've been intrigued by Brantley since we met him in The Silver Swan and as the series continued my obsession with finding out what was going on behind his soulless eyes has grown. I feel like I've been waiting years for Brantley's story and to understand him.Brantley Vitiosis is The Elite Kings weapon, he's the Dark King, the one who has and shows no emotion. He's collected because nothing affects him and able to ask the difficult questions or challenge those in charge because no one and nothing can scare Bran Bran.Except Saint. Saint Dea Vitosis, is the light to Brantley's dark. She's his opposite in every way and the only person who manages to bring any level of emotion out of him. Brantley has kept Saint hidden away from almost everyone in his life, he won't let himself have her, but no one else can have her either.The dynamic between these two characters was so interesting to read because they were opposites, but seemed to fit into each other's lives so effortlessly. Where do I start........ It was great to be back in The Elite Kings world, Sancte Diaboli picks up right where Malum Part 2 ended with Saint coming down the stairs in the Vitiosis mansion. As ever the book is filled with the typical King attitude, self assured behaviour, plot twists, mind blowing theories, and an abundance of sexual chemistry. A good portion of the book seemed to establish the world of The Kings with Saint, bringing her up to speed with what/who they are. The majority of the information isn't new of course but I understand why that process was needed. The book is seen through Saint's POV as well as Brantley's and the occasional chapter from Bishop.So what I enjoyed about the book was the relationships and the easy banter between The Kings, the quick wit and sass of Tillie, her and Nate still give me life. As I said the chemistry still leaps off the page, the possessiveness of the Kings still makes me weak at the knee's. Getting to know more about Brantley and what he went through was something I have been waiting for, for so long and he didn't disappoint. I love reading these books and never knowing where the story is going to go, expect the unexpected they say but I have no clue what the unexpected is, when it comes to Amo I just sit back and enjoy the ride. Bishop and Saint's relationship completely surprised me and we see a whole new side to him we haven't seen before and that gets a big thumbs up from me.What I didn't enjoy is a little harder to express, the novel didn't revolve around Brantley and Saint as much as I expected. I do believe this is because we still have to keep progressing the Madship storyline and Saint needs to be brought up to speed on everything within this generation of Kings so far. Brantley's kink - now the act itself doesn't bother me, it's the way it was written made me feel we were going full on PNR vibes and I wasn't a fan. Then towards the back of end of the story there is an aspect that is almost within a Fantasy trope territory and that isn't where I see this series going, that just confused me and I can't wrap my head around it at the moment.The first 75% of the book felt like coming home, playing in familiar territory. The last 25% is where things picked up speed and things were coming into play that give you all the feelings like there are new players to the game - The Gentlemen, and there is more going on that we aren't being clued into yet.
